The historic Bradley Block in downtown Bucksport includes five, fully occupied apartments with stunning harbor views and a 3,000 sq. ft. turnkey restaurant space. The recent retirement of MacLeod's Restaurant owner after 45 successful years has created an extraordinary opportunity for a new owner who can either lease or operate the restaurant. This high-visibility location on Main Street is adjacent to public parking and within 500' of Bucksport's marina and waterfront park. Substantial renovations include a new furnace, electric entrance, lead-safe certification, sprinkler system, replacement windows, and cellulose insulation. The circa 1840 building features four spacious 2-bedroom apartments with spectacular views of the harbor and Penobscot Narrows Bridge plus one studio apartment. This prime location has been key to the success of MacLeod's with regular customers from Castine and Blue Hill peninsulas, Belfast, Ellsworth, Bangor and beyond.
